The Squirrel (Old Kingdom Rumian: Бѣлъка; gn. Old Kingdom Rumian: Béloka; Old Pladish: Věvełka) is a historiographic encyclopedia by the Rumian historian, scientist, and writer Isabella (Old Kingdom Rumian: Исабєла Ромєнска; gn. Old Kingdom Rumian: Isabela Romenská; Old Pladish: Izabela Rumiański). The first edition was first published both or either in Old Kingdom Rumian and Old Pladish at the Proudok Printing Mill and the University of Rothene, respectively, in around 1825-18██. It was translated into New High Bandard as de Eikhurnelīn in 18██. The second edition was published in 1███, translated into Pladish as Wiewiórka in ████ and into Bandard as das Eikhörnken in ████.
Background
A letter in October 1███ is the first recorded mention of Isabella's intent to write a history of the Blest Hethian Principate. She stopped, discarded, and resumed the project multiple times throughout her life. As a debutante, she expressed interest towards the personal and familial historical artifacts of dozens of Bandard and Rumian nobility. Throughout the later half of her life, she toured Bandardy and its neighboring countries to record historical items, texts, and oral accounts of the early to middle history of the Blest Hethian Principate.

Content
The Squirrel is the first comprehensive historical record of the ████████ ██████ and the Blest Hethian Principate. It was originally recorded non-chronologically until its republication in 1███, in which it was reformatted into chronological articles and includes a table of contents.
The second edition of The Squirrel separates each chapter into "hearsay" and "honest" halves. Each "hearsay" section is a collection of likely fictional records and accounts of that chapter's subject, while each "honest" section is, according to Isabella, a collection of true records and accounts of that chapter's subject.

The Squirrel references dozens of other historical texts, the vast majority of which are lost (e.g. the fifth Book of ████████ by ███ █████ and several missing articles in the History of the Religious Wars by Prokop). It is the only surviving evidence of many of these works having ever existed.
